[PATCH v5 7/8] OMAP: adapt hsmmc to hwmod framework

[Date Prev][Date Next][Thread Prev][Thread Next][Date Index][Thread Index]

 



Changes involves:
1) Remove controller reset in devices.c which is taken care of
   by hwmod framework.
2) Omap2420 platform consists of mmc block as in omap1 and not the
   hsmmc block as present in omap2430, omap3, omap4 platforms.
   Removing all base address macro defines except keeping one for OMAP2420.
3) Using omap-device layer to register device and utilizing data from
   hwmod data file for base address, dma channel number, Irq_number,
   device attribute.
4) Update the driver to use dev_attr to find whether controller
   supports dual volt cards
